Transaction d75f76fc0715743393b263198718c960b6aa5af4ca3c2f8eb61c9965e2e9016c
1 Input
1 Output
-
d75f76fc0715743393b263198718c960b6aa5af4ca3c2f8eb61c9965e2e9016c:0
- value
- 15933186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72fe8d3ec104ae83e3960d5211c0e430831cf3ed OP_EQUAL
- address
- 3CB3tydtZwiqbfuk4NU9rQsmUfRtSbDMjs